The story of the Miami Open

Why the Miami Open matters in 2026

The Miami Open runs in Miami, United States from 18–29 Mar, played on medium-paced hard court. Bounces and pace sit between clay and grass, which rewards all-court players who can defend, attack and serve in roughly equal measure. It is a Masters 1000 / WTA 1000, the tier directly below the Slams and mandatory for the world top thirty outside of injury. The singles champion takes 1,000 ranking points, plus a prize pool that sits second only to the Slams.

First held in 1985, played at Hard Rock Stadium, Miami Gardens. The 2026 edition has wrapped. The full results sit below; the recap and the 2027 dates are above.

Past champions

Recent Miami Open champions

The tournament was first held in 1985, played at Hard Rock Stadium, Miami Gardens.

Men's singles

YearChampionRunner-upScore
2025CZEJakub MenšíkNovak Djokovic7-6 7-6
2024ITAJannik SinnerGrigor Dimitrov6-3 6-1
2023RUSDaniil MedvedevJannik Sinner7-5 6-3
2022ESPCarlos AlcarazCasper Ruud7-5 6-4
2021POLHubert HurkaczJannik Sinner7-6 6-4
2019SUIRoger FedererJohn Isner6-1 6-4

Women's singles

YearChampionRunner-upScore
2025BLRAryna SabalenkaJessica Pegula7-5 6-2
2024USADanielle CollinsElena Rybakina7-5 6-3
2023CZEPetra KvitováElena Rybakina7-6 6-2
2022POLIga ŚwiątekNaomi Osaka6-4 6-0
2021AUSAshleigh BartyBianca Andreescu6-3 4-0 ret.
2019AUSAshleigh BartyKarolína Plíšková7-6 6-3
